1、服务器性能、2、网络问题、3、代码优化、4、资源加载
Vue官网的慢速加载体验可能源于多个因素。首先,服务器性能不佳会导致响应时间过长;其次,网络问题如带宽限制或网络延迟也会影响加载速度;第三,代码优化不足,尤其是未优化的JavaScript和CSS文件,会拖慢页面渲染;最后,资源加载如果存在大量的图片、视频或其他静态资源,未使用缓存或压缩技术,也会显著影响网站速度。
一、服务器性能
服务器性能是影响网站速度的一个关键因素。如果服务器的硬件配置较低,如CPU、内存等资源不足,处理大量请求时就会变慢。此外,服务器的地理位置也会影响加载速度。如果服务器离用户较远,数据传输时间会增加,导致网站加载缓慢。
二、网络问题
网络问题也会影响用户访问Vue官网的速度。这包括用户的网络带宽、ISP服务质量以及网络延迟等。以下是一些具体问题:
- 带宽限制:如果用户的网络带宽有限,下载网站内容所需的时间会更长。
- 网络延迟:网络中间节点过多或网络拥堵会增加数据传输的延迟。
- ISP服务质量:不同的ISP提供的网络服务质量差异较大,某些ISP可能会有较高的网络抖动或丢包现象。
三、代码优化
代码优化不足是另一个导致网站慢速加载的原因。具体包括:
- 未压缩的JavaScript和CSS文件:未压缩的文件体积较大,下载和解析时间较长。
- 代码冗余:包含无用的代码或重复的代码段,会增加处理时间。
- 未使用代码分割:未对代码进行分割,导致用户在初次加载时需要下载大量的代码文件。
四、资源加载
资源加载是指网站上需要加载的各种静态资源,如图片、视频、字体等。这些资源如果未进行优化,也会导致网站加载缓慢。具体包括:
- 图片未压缩:未压缩的图片文件体积较大,加载时间长。
- 未使用缓存:未使用浏览器缓存技术,每次访问都需要重新加载资源。
- 未使用CDN:未使用内容分发网络(CDN),导致资源加载速度较慢。
五、具体案例分析
为了更好地理解上述原因,以下是几个具体的案例分析:
- GitHub Pages托管:假设Vue官网托管在GitHub Pages上,而GitHub的服务器位于美国。这意味着非美国用户访问时可能会遇到较高的网络延迟。
- 未使用CDN:如果Vue官网未使用CDN进行资源分发,全球用户访问时需要从单一服务器下载资源,导致加载时间增加。
- 大文件未压缩:如果Vue官网中的JavaScript文件和图片文件未进行压缩,用户在访问时需要下载较大的文件,增加了加载时间。
六、优化建议
为了提升Vue官网的加载速度,可以考虑以下优化建议:
- 升级服务器硬件:提升服务器的CPU、内存等硬件配置,确保能够处理大量请求。
- 使用CDN:使用内容分发网络(CDN)分发静态资源,减少加载时间。
- 压缩文件:对JavaScript、CSS和图片文件进行压缩,减少文件体积。
- 启用浏览器缓存:利用浏览器缓存技术,减少重复加载资源。
- 代码分割:对代码进行分割,按需加载,减少初次加载时间。
总结
Vue官网加载慢的原因可能是多方面的,包括服务器性能、网络问题、代码优化和资源加载等。为了提升网站速度,可以从优化服务器硬件、使用CDN、压缩文件、启用缓存和代码分割等方面入手。通过这些措施,不仅可以提升用户体验,还能提高网站的SEO表现,吸引更多的访问者。
相关问答FAQs:
为什么vue官网加载速度较慢?
-
服务器响应时间: Vue官网可能遇到服务器响应时间较长的问题。服务器响应时间是指从用户发出请求到服务器返回响应所需要的时间。如果服务器响应时间过长,会导致官网加载速度慢。这可能是由于服务器负载过高、网络拥塞或者服务器配置不当等原因引起的。
-
网络连接问题: 官网加载速度慢可能与用户的网络连接有关。如果用户的网络连接不稳定或者带宽较小,会导致官网加载速度变慢。此外,如果用户所处的地理位置与服务器的位置相距较远,也可能导致官网加载速度慢。
-
页面优化问题: 官网加载速度慢可能是由于页面优化不充分所致。页面优化包括压缩资源、合并文件、使用缓存等措施来减少页面的加载时间。如果官网没有进行这些优化措施,就会导致加载速度慢。
如何解决vue官网加载速度慢的问题?
-
优化服务器响应时间: 可以通过升级服务器硬件、优化服务器配置、增加服务器带宽等方式来改善服务器响应时间。此外,可以通过使用CDN(内容分发网络)来将静态资源缓存在离用户较近的服务器上,从而加快页面加载速度。
-
改善网络连接质量: 用户可以尝试连接更稳定的网络,增加带宽或者使用VPN等方式来改善网络连接质量。此外,选择一个离用户地理位置较近的服务器也可以提高加载速度。
-
进行页面优化: 对于Vue官网来说,可以对资源文件进行压缩、合并,减少HTTP请求的次数。同时,使用浏览器缓存来缓存静态资源,减少重复加载的次数。还可以使用懒加载技术,延迟加载页面中的部分内容,提高页面的加载速度。
如何评估vue官网的加载速度?
-
使用网页性能测试工具: 可以使用一些网页性能测试工具来评估Vue官网的加载速度,例如Google PageSpeed Insights、GTmetrix等。这些工具可以提供关于页面性能的详细报告,包括加载时间、响应时间、资源优化建议等。
-
使用浏览器开发者工具: 浏览器开发者工具中提供了网络面板,可以查看页面加载的各个请求的时间和资源大小。通过分析网络面板的数据,可以评估Vue官网的加载速度。
-
用户反馈: 可以向用户收集反馈,了解他们在访问Vue官网时的加载速度感受。用户反馈可以提供直观的体验信息,帮助评估官网的加载速度。
文章标题:为什么vue官网那么慢,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/3601776